That is why the upcoming LINK Outlet Store Singapore Christmas Atrium Event at Singapore EXPO has quickly become one of the more notable shopping opportunities this festive season.
Running from 5 to 7 December 2025, this short yet impactful sale brings together a wide mix of well-known brands, including Adidas, Puma, Under Armour, Zanetta, Waveline, Crocs and several others. Their team will be setting up at Singapore EXPO Level 2, Foyer 2, offering discounts of up to 80 per cent on footwear, apparel and accessories. Promotional/Event Details:
Date: 5 to 7 December 2025
Time: 11am to 9pm daily
Venue: Singapore EXPO Level 2, Foyer 2, 1 Expo Dr, #01-65, Singapore 486150
